#328529 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#328529 is composed of 19.6% red, 52.2%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.2%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 114.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 34.1%. #328529 color hex could be obtained by blending #64ff52 with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#328529 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#328529 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#328529 has RGB values of R:50, G:133,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 3310889.

Shades and Tints of #328529
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050d04 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#328529
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525d51 is the less saturated color, while #12ad01 is the most saturated one.
